Can You Find My Eid Presents?

by A. M. Dassu, illustrated by Junissa Bianda

Interest age: 2 to 5

Published by Scholastic, 2024

  • Picture books

About this book

It's the day before Eid, and Mummy needs help. She asks Hana to get the Eid presents from her room.

But Hana can't find them. They're not in the wardrobe, they're not in the bathroom. They're not even in the shed! Eid won't be special without presents. What will Hana do?

A delightful picture book that will have the reader rooting for Hana to find the presents. It's refreshing to have an Eid story based around a search-and-find element, rather than the family traditions.

The illustrations are warm and friendly, allowing every child to put themselves in Hana's shoes. No presents – imagine! There are some nice domestic details to spot, too, like the cat who tries to help Hana. A charming picture book for all families.

About the author

A. M. Dassu is a former World Book Day author and internationally acclaimed author of 14 children’s books, including Boy, Everywhere, Fight Back and Kicked Out, which have collectively been listed for over 55 awards, including the Carnegie Medal, Waterstones Children’s Book Prize and Week Junior Book Award. 

She is a director at Inclusive Minds, a patron of The Other Side of Hope, an international literary magazine edited by immigrants and refugees, and one of The National Literacy Trust’s Connecting Stories campaign authors, aiming to help inspire a love of reading and writing in children and young people.
